PRE AND POST DEVELOPMENT NON-POINT SOURCE LOADING STUDY BAREFOOT LANDING RESORT, MYRTLE BEACH, SC
Abstract
In 2000, development of approximately 1,700 acres of land adjacent to the west bank of the Intra-coastal Waterway (ICW) in Myrtle Beach, SC was initiated. The developers of this project proposed simultaneous construction of four championship 18-hole golf courses, a hotel complex, multi-family dwellings as well as various residential communities.
